Germany ends fast-track citizenship as mood on migration shifts

Friedrich Merz’s conservatives had pledged to rescind legislation, which allowed citizenship in three years instead of five

Germany’s parliament has rescinded a fast-track citizenship programme, reflecting the rapidly shifting mood on migration in Europe’s labour-hungry economic powerhouse.

Chancellor Friedrich Merz’s conservatives pledged in this year’s election campaign to rescind the legislation, which let people deemed “exceptionally well integrated” gain citizenship in three years instead of five.
